Subject aims expressed by acquired skills and competences

An aim of a course is practise of procedures and methods of data collection by using MGIT, that students met during theirs earlier studies. The student must demonstrate the ability to independently: 1) Prepare a mapping project in accordance with the specified criteria 2) To implement the field work for a specified area 3) To evaluate the results of field work and write a report on the mapping 4) To co-ordinate the process with other students within work group

Subject syllabus:

A learners get a defined task and geodata which are nescessary to completet the task. A goal of the learners is to finish task in defined time by using their knowledge. 1) To prepare project - basemap data, mapping project, mapping equipment. 2) To accomplish a field work so that: - all objectives are covered, - all required documentation is created. 3) To process all fieldwork outputs according to defined goal.
